That's not really surprising ... you're still freeing PMD tables without calling the destructor, which means that you're leaking ptlocks on configs that can't embed the ptlock in the struct page. I suppose it shows that you're leaking a PMD table rather than a PTE table, so that might help track it down. Checking for PG_table in free_unref_page() and calling show_stack() will probably help more. _______________________________________________ Linux-nvdimm mailing list -- linux-nvdimm@lists.01.org To unsubscribe send an email to linux-nvdimm-leave@lists.01.org
